And also because trading down relinquishes the power of getting YOUR guy. If you're Andy Reid and you're convinced Geno Smith or Matt Barkley can give you what Donovan McNabb gave you for 10 years or more, is it worth risking that to move down and pick up an extra second round pick this year and a first round pick of unknown value NEXT year? There are so many teams with QB needs - Jacksonville, Oakland, Philadelphia in the top 5, throw in Arizona, Buffalo and New York Jets in the top 10 - that you could see TWO guys go between your original slot and your new, trade-down slot. Trading down just isn't on the table.

I'm talking about moving DOWN in the draft to get the guy you want and getting more picks as opposed to taking him were your pick is. In the best draft the 49ers ever had they traded out of the first out altogether. They still ended up with Tom Rathman, Charles Haley, John Taylor, and several others. Sometimes its trading UP like Walsh did to go get Jerry Rice. All I'm saying is DON'T REACH. Move back for more picks or move up for a guy you really want. Dallas did that to built their dynasty with Jimmy Johnson and the Pats did it more recently to not only get to the topbu STAY THERE. Again...not saying "don't take Geno". I'm saying he may not be the best pick at #1. Trading that pick is probably the best option. There is no magic bullet. One thing I know from watching Alex....putting HUGE pressure on a kid as the savior tends to make them crumble. |
